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are in the historic center of Colonia del Sacramento near Plaza Mayor, head southeast towards the Rambla de las Americas. From Plaza Mayor, walk down Calle del Comercio until you reach the waterfront. Turn right onto the Rambla and continue walking until you reach Muelle de Colonia. The Muelle is located at Dr. Emilio Frugoni, G5F4+QWP, and you will see it clearly as you approach the water.

  • Bicycle

    For those who prefer cycling, rent a bicycle from one of the local shops in the city. Start from the historic center and head towards the Rambla de las Americas. Follow the waterfront path along the Rambla, which will lead you directly to Muelle de Colonia. The ride is scenic and takes approximately 10 to 15 minutes.

  • Public Transport

    Though public transport options are limited within Colonia del Sacramento, you can catch a local bus heading towards the waterfront area from the central bus station. Ask the driver to drop you off near the Rambla de las Americas. From there, it's a short walk to Muelle de Colonia, located at Dr. Emilio Frugoni, G5F4+QWP.

Discover more about Muelle de Colonia

Muelle de Colonia, or the Colonia Pier, is a captivating waterfront destination located in the historic town of Colonia del Sacramento, Uruguay. This scenic spot offers breathtaking views of the Río de la Plata, where visitors can enjoy the soothing sounds of the water lapping against the shore. As you stroll along the pier, you'll be enveloped in the rich history that permeates this UNESCO World Heritage site. The charming old town, with its cobblestone streets and colonial architecture, is just a stone's throw away, inviting exploration and discovery. The pier is a popular gathering place for both locals and tourists alike, making it a vibrant hub of activity. On any given day, you may find artists painting, musicians performing, or families enjoying a leisurely outing. The atmosphere at Muelle de Colonia is truly unique, especially during sunset when the sky transforms into a canvas of brilliant colors reflecting off the water. It's an ideal setting for romantic walks or peaceful moments of solitude, providing a perfect backdrop for photographs. Additionally, there are numerous cafes and shops nearby where you can savor local delicacies or pick up a souvenir to remember your visit. The Muelle de Colonia is not just a tourist attraction; it's a cultural experience that encapsulates the spirit of Colonia del Sacramento, making it an essential stop on your journey through Uruguay.
